Many people enjoy playing games as a source of entertainment as well as a way to have some fun. But, participating in games will also provide you with a way to improve concentration. A great number of games exist that can do this for you. Many people have become addicted to a game called Sudoku to help improve concentration.

This is a numbers puzzle that uses a grid. The grid is filled in using numbers 1 through 9, and each line going across or down will only have the digits 1 through 9 listed one time. It is a game that requires you to use deductive reasoning because there are several possibilities for each square on the grid until you start working to narrow them down.
